Effects of intrastriatal injections of haloperidol (Dopamine antagonist) and D-amphetamine (Dopamine agonist) on lordosis behaviour were studied in ovariectomized female albino rats, after priming with subcutaneous injections of estrogen and progesterone. The lordosis quotient (LQ) significantly increased after haloperidol, and decreased following D-amphetamine treatment. However, the inhibitor...

Preincubation of rat hypothalamic slices in glucose-free Krebs-Ringer buffer (37 degrees C) resulted in a time-dependent decrease in specific (+)-[3H]amphetamine binding in the crude synaptosomal fraction prepared from these slices. The addition of D-glucose resulted in a dose- and time-dependent stimulation of (+)-[3H]amphetamine binding, whereas incubation with L-glucose, 2-deoxy-D-glucose, o...

The purpose of this study was to examine the anxiety-related effects of acute and repeated amphetamine administration using the elevated plus maze (EPM) and light/dark box tests in mice. D-amphetamine (2 mg/kg ip, 30 min after injection) had a significant anxiogenic effect only in the EPM test, as shown by specific decreases in the percentage of time spent in the open arms as well as in the per...

Rats were trained to turn for water reinforcement and then were given unilateral 6-hydroxydopamine lesions. After lesion, rats showed deficits in trained turning both contra- and ipsilateral to the side of the lesion, with contralateral turning more severely impaired. The lesioned rats were then transplanted with fetal mesencephalic dopamine tissue into striatum. A control group of lesioned rat...

Experience-dependent changes in behavior are thought to involve structural modifications in the nervous system, especially alterations in patterns of synaptic connectivity. Repeated experience with drugs of abuse can result in very long-lasting changes in behavior, including a persistent hypersensitivity (sensitization) to their psychomotor activating and rewarding effects. The aim of this study was to trace D-amphetamine toxicity in isolated rat hepatocytes and to elucidate a possible involvement of CYP3A in the mechanisms of its toxicity. To this end, male Wistar rats were treated with nifedipine (5 mg kg(-1) i.p., 5 days), a substrate and inducer of CYP3A. Hepatocytes isolated from nifedipine-treated and control rats were incubated with D-amphetamine at a conce...

Previous research in this laboratory has shown that a diet of intermittent excessive sugar consumption produces a state with neurochemical and behavioral similarities to drug dependency. The present study examined whether female rats on various regimens of sugar access would show behavioral cross-sensitization to a low dose of amphetamine. Abstract Introduction Cocaineand amphetamine-regulated transcript peptides have been implicated in the endocrine and autonomic regulation, food intake and anxiety. Anatomical studies demonstrate that cocaineand amphetamine-regulated transcript mRNA and peptides are expressed intensely in the hypothalamo-pituitary-adrenal gland axis and sympatho-adrenal system. Hair analysis is a reliable tool for detecting long-term exposure to illegal drugs, including amphetaminetype stimulants, over periods from a few weeks to a few months, depending on the length of the hair used for analysis. Between 2000 and 2012, over 600 hair samples were analysed at the Institute for Medical Research and Occupational Health, Croatia (IMROH) for the presence of amphetamine-typ...

BACKGROUND The neurotransmitter norepinephrine has been implicated in psychiatric and neurodegenerative disorders. Examination of synaptic norepinephrine concentrations in the living brain may be possible with positron emission tomography (PET), but has been hampered by the lack of suitable radioligands.
